DOHA, 9 June 2003 — The OPEC oil group will not switch dollar-denominated oil sales to the euro, despite the fall in the value of the US currency, OPEC’s President said yesterday. Abdullah Al-Attiyah, also oil minister for Qatar, said the dollar’s decline versus other leading currencies like the euro and the yen had hurt OPEC revenues and helped oil importing nations. “We are facing a very difficult situation with the dollar,” he told reporters in Qatar ahead of this week’s Organization of the Petroleum Exporting Countries meeting in Doha.
